  • How is the weather in Delmenhorst?

    Delmenhorst has cool winters around 31–42°F (-1–6°C) and mild summers near 55–74°F (13–24°C), with rainfall spread through the year. Light layers and a rain jacket help with shifting conditions.

  • What are the best places to visit in Delmenhorst?

    Frequently suggested sites in Delmenhorst include the city’s old water tower, art nouveau-inspired city hall, and spacious municipal parks. Exploring local museums provides insight into the region’s heritage.

  • What are the best foods to try in Delmenhorst?

    Regional North German cuisine influences Delmenhorst’s food scene, with dishes like smoked fish, hearty stews, and rye bread commonly found. Local bakeries often serve up sweet yeast cakes and seasonal specialties.
